Inside Casey Jones Museum you'll find travel information on beautiful and historic Southwest Tennessee and Tennessee provided by the Tourism Association of Southwest Tennessee. Casey Jones Village is also a Wi-Fi hotspot so bring your laptop or tablet. We are conveniently located on Interstate 40 at exit 80A between the musical meccas of Memphis and Nashville in historic Jackson, Tennessee. Jackson is at the Crossroads of the Music Highway & the Rock-a-billy Highway.
The Casey Jones Museum is more interesting than I originally thought it would be. It's a self-guided tour that begins with a short informational video. The museum contains several authentic railroad artifacts. You can access Casey's home, and it's pretty well reserved. The museum also has a life-sized model train that you can climb and ring the bell. Across from the museum is a buffet-style restaurant. Everything is located right off the highway, so it's quick and easy to access. It's worth a quick stop.
